After looking at those websites you showed us, the young people who stuck out to me the most were Jake Fisher and Weina Scott, both 17, who started Switchpod, a pod casting website.  These two people live thousands of miles away from each other  but still run a business together that they started in high school at very young ages.  I can tell that these people have the right attitude to succeed in life, but most importantly their hard workers.  These high school students currently make a really good amount of money just off of this website.  What I read in this article that really stood out to me was that these specific individuals had the drive and smarts to create a legit business, at the beginning of a new technology bubble, so there would be room for improvement and new ideas. It is amazing that people at such a young age can accomplish so much due to their drive to succeed and their pure knowledge.
